Watercoolers Europe (WE) was established in 1993, originally known as the European Bottled Watercooler Association (EBWA). As a non-profit, non-governmental international organisation, WE is dedicated to advancing the watercooler industry across Greater Europe.


In 1998, WE expanded with the opening of its Brussels office, becoming an Association of National Associations – an essential structure for engaging with EU regulatory and policymaking bodies. This positioning enables WE to effectively advocate on behalf of its members.


Today, WE represents both the bottled watercooler and Point-of-Use (POU) sectors, with membership comprising national associations, bottlers, distributors, and directly related supplier companies. In total, WE represents over 300 individual companies across Europe.


As a central hub of knowledge, expertise, and professional resources, WE supports the watercooler industry by addressing common concerns and facilitating the exchange of technical, scientific and regulatory information. Through these efforts, WE helps its members maintain stringent quality standards, achieve business success, and safeguard their investments.


WE ensures that members stay informed about evolving EU legislation and actively participates in political and regulatory processes to shape new laws in the industry's favour. It engages with industry stakeholders, governmental bodies, and public agencies, coordinating unified positions and presenting a collective voice to regulatory authorities.


Furthermore, WE champions high standards through independent and self-regulatory initiatives, including the development of a Code of Hygiene to safeguard consumer protection and a Code of Ethics to uphold the professionalism and integrity of its members.
